The Uplands

Part of the Greater Edmonton metropolitan area, The Uplands is a neighbourhood within Edmonton, Alberta.

Transportation

Driving is a great mode of transportation in The Uplands. Many real estate listings are a reasonably short car ride from the closest highway, and it is very convenient to park. In contrast, public transit riders may have very few options in this area due to the low service level. The Uplands is moderately bike-friendly since the bicycling infrastructure is reasonably well-developed. It is very difficult for people travelling by foot to get around in The Uplands because running common errands is challenging without a car.

Services

There are no high schools and no primary schools in The Uplands. Furthermore, it can be very difficult to reach daycares as a pedestrian. With respect to eating, property owners in The Uplands almost always have to rely on a vehicle to travel to the closest supermarket.

Character

The Uplands is a very good neighbourhood to buy a house in for those who prefer a slower-paced atmosphere. It is easy to reach public green spaces since there are a few of them close by for residents to relax in. This neighbourhood is also very good for those who like a quiet atmosphere, as there isn't a lot of street noise or city clamour.

Housing

The large percentage of single detached homes in the housing stock of The Uplands is an important part of its character. This part of Edmonton offers mainly four or more bedroom and three bedroom homes. Homeowners occupy nearly 95% of the dwellings in the neighbourhood whereas the rest are rented. A majority of the housing growth in this area has taken place following the year 2000.
